Cutting-edge techniques and innovations in structural glazing.

The combination of glass and metal has allowed architects to push design boundaries, creating structures that blend aesthetics and functionality seamlessly. From iconic skyscrapers to avant-garde cultural institutions, structural glazing is now an essential part of the city’s architecture.

But what exactly is structural glazing? Essentially, it involves using glass as a load-bearing element in a building’s structure, rather than purely for aesthetics. This revolutionary approach has opened up endless possibilities for architects, enabling larger areas of uninterrupted glass and creating a sense of transparency and lightness.

One of the main advantages of structural glazing is its ability to improve energy efficiency. By using high-performance glass and advanced insulation techniques, heat loss is significantly reduced, resulting in lower energy consumption and carbon emissions.

This benefits both the environment and a building’s operational costs.Achieving the perfect balance between structural integrity and visual impact is no easy task, but London’s architectural glazing pioneers have risen to the challenge.

They have mastered the art of integrating glass and metal seamlessly, creating visually stunning and structurally sound buildings.However, structural glazing isn’t just about aesthetics and energy efficiency.

It also offers improved acoustic performance, providing a quieter environment for occupants in busy urban areas. Additionally, the use of laminated glass enhances safety and security, as it remains intact even if shattered, reducing the risk of injury.

Frequently Asked Questions

Architectural structural glazing is a technique that involves the use of transparent glass panels to create a structural element within a building’s design. This glazing method allows for the creation of large, frameless glass facades, windows, and skylights, providing unobstructed views and flooding interior spaces with natural light.

No, architectural structural glazing is not only used for aesthetic purposes. While it does enhance the visual appeal of a building by creating a sleek and modern look, it also offers various functional benefits. Structural glazing improves thermal performance, energy efficiency, sound insulation, and can contribute to the overall sustainability of a building.

Yes, structural glazing can be used for high-rise buildings. The technique allows for the creation of large, uninterrupted glass surfaces that can withstand the wind loads and other structural demands of tall structures. Proper engineering and design considerations are essential to ensure the safety and stability of the glazing system in high-rise applications.

While architectural structural glazing offers many benefits, it does have some limitations. The size and weight of the glass panels may pose challenges during installation. Additionally, careful consideration must be given to factors such as thermal expansion, deflection, and potential condensation. Collaborating with experienced architects and glazing specialists is crucial to address these limitations and ensure a successful installation.

Yes, there are regulations and standards governing the use of structural glazing to ensure safety and quality. These standards may vary across different regions. It is important to consult local building codes and work with certified professionals who are knowledgeable about the applicable regulations to ensure compliance with the relevant standards.

Yes, existing buildings can incorporate architectural structural glazing through retrofitting or renovation projects. However, this would require careful assessment of the building’s structural capacity, feasibility studies, and adherence to applicable regulations. Collaborating with experienced professionals is key to successfully integrating structural glazing into an existing building.
